Transaction 57085b26738012d7402ee5c58697a2e285dd2ec22fdabd9a00ce21d1a9ee7297
1 Input
1 Output
-
57085b26738012d7402ee5c58697a2e285dd2ec22fdabd9a00ce21d1a9ee7297:0
- value
- 40597983
- script pubkey
- OP_0 OP_PUSHBYTES_20 6fe94a1f4d6470c8ab86011e26c8aacbca2e3bb7
- address
- bc1qdl55586dv3cv32uxqy0zdj92e09zuwahd405u9